Facebook Marketplace Lets You Buy From And Sell To People Nearby

Android/iOS: You’ve probably already seen people you know selling stuff online through Facebook. Now the company has decided to get in on the action with the new Marketplace, which makes it easier to buy and sell with people near you.

While this isn’t Facebook’s first foray into letting people sell stuff through its site, it seems to be one of the cleanest. Head to the new Marketplace tab (currently rolling out to the Android and iOS Facebook apps) and you’ll see listings for things people are selling near you. You can search for specific items or browse categories like Household or Electronics.

If you want to sell something, you can make your listing relatively easily. Simply describe what you’re selling, add a picture and a price, then give it a location. You don’t need to enter your specific address (thankfully) but you’ll need to meet up with the buyer at some point, so stay safe. The Marketplace gives buyers and sellers special messaging tools to communicate so you don’t have to deal with letting potential buyers into your friends list or worry about privacy settings just to communicate.
